Magnus Carlsen, the world’s top chess player, has won the SuperUnited Rapid and Blitz 2025 tournament held in Zagreb, Croatia. He secured the title on July 7, 2025, with one round to spare. The event is part of the Grand Chess Tour and brings together top chess players from around the world. This win shows Carlsen’s strong form, while India’s D Gukesh also impressed by finishing third.
Carlsen Dominates the Tournament
The SuperUnited Rapid and Blitz is a fast-paced chess event where players compete in two formats—Rapid and Blitz. Magnus Carlsen played very well throughout and confirmed his win by drawing with India’s R Praggnanandhaa in the second-last round. He then defeated Ivan Saric of Croatia in the final round, ending with a total score of 22.5 out of 36.
Wesley So, a top player from the USA, came in second with 20 points. He had a strong final day, scoring more than Carlsen in the last 9 games of Blitz. However, it wasn’t enough to catch up.
Gukesh Impresses with Third Place Finish
India’s D Gukesh, who is the current World Champion, surprised many by doing well in the Rapid format, which is not usually his strong point. He struggled a bit in the Blitz games but made a good recovery in the second half, scoring 4 out of 9, and finishing with 19.5 points.
In his Blitz rematch with Carlsen, Gukesh played a Berlin defense, which led to a draw. His performance shows how quickly he is improving in faster formats, even though he is just 19 years old.
What’s Next: Saint Louis Rapid and Blitz
The next event in the Grand Chess Tour will be held at the Saint Louis Chess Club in Missouri, USA from August 10 to 16, 2025. This will be the fourth event of the season and another chance for top players to earn points and prepare for bigger championships. Fans can expect more exciting games and strong competition.
